About Ethics and Professional Responsibility Law in Happy Valley, Hong Kong

Ethics and Professional Responsibility law in Happy Valley, Hong Kong pertains to the standards and codes of conduct expected within various professions. These laws are designed to maintain integrity, accountability, and public trust by ensuring professionals adhere to ethical guidelines. In Happy Valley, as in the broader jurisdiction of Hong Kong, such standards are crucial for upholding the quality and credibility of professionals, ranging from legal practitioners to medical personnel and corporate executives.

Local Laws Overview

The local laws in Happy Valley regarding Ethics and Professional Responsibility are part of a broader framework applicable throughout Hong Kong, guided by statutory provisions and professional body regulations. Key aspects include the Professional Accountants Ordinance, governing accountants; the Legal Practitioners Ordinance, for lawyers; and the Medical Registration Ordinance, applicable to medical professionals. Compliance with these laws ensures professionals meet their ethical duties, and violations may result in disciplinary measures or legal ramifications.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is meant by 'professional misconduct' in Hong Kong?

Professional misconduct in Hong Kong involves actions that fall below the standards expected of a professional in their field, potentially leading to disciplinary actions or legal consequences.

How can I file a complaint against a professional in Happy Valley?

Complaints can usually be filed with the relevant professional regulatory body. For example, complaints against lawyers can be directed to the Law Society of Hong Kong.

Can ethical violations lead to criminal charges?

While ethical violations typically lead to professional disciplinary actions, severe breaches may also result in criminal charges, especially if laws have been broken.

What is the role of a lawyer in handling professional responsibility cases?

A lawyer can help navigate the legal complexities of professional responsibility cases, offer strategic advice, represent clients in proceedings, and work to protect their rights and reputation.

Are there standard penalties for breaches of professional ethics?

Penalties vary depending on the profession, the severity of the breach, and the guidelines set by the respective regulatory body. They can range from fines to suspension or revocation of the professional license.

Do professionals in Happy Valley need mandatory ethics training?

Many professions require ongoing ethics training as part of their continuing professional development to ensure up-to-date knowledge of ethical standards and compliance.

How can I ensure I'm compliant with local ethical standards?

Consulting with a legal expert in professional ethics and regularly reviewing the regulations from relevant professional bodies are effective ways to maintain compliance.

What should I do if accused of an ethical violation?

If accused, it is important to consult with a lawyer specializing in Ethics and Professional Responsibility immediately to understand the allegations and prepare a robust defense.

Are there whistleblower protections in Hong Kong?

Hong Kong has policies to protect whistleblowers who report unethical behavior, though the specifics depend on the domain and involved parties.

How long do ethical investigations typically take?

The duration of investigations can vary widely depending on the complexity of the case, the investigative body's resources, and the cooperation of involved parties.

Additional Resources

Several resources and organizations in Happy Valley and Hong Kong can assist those needing legal advice in Ethics and Professional Responsibility. These include the Law Society of Hong Kong, Hong Kong Bar Association, and relevant professional bodies such as the Hong Kong Institute of Certified Public Accountants and the Medical Council of Hong Kong. Additionally, educational programs and literature on professional ethics can provide guidance.
